#8c6c1e basic color information

#8c6c1e

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#8c6c1e has decimal index of: 9202718, is composed of 54.9% red, 42.4% green and 11.8% blue. #8c6c1e in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 22.9% magenta, 78.6% yellow and 45.1% black.
#996633 is the closest web-safe color to #8c6c1e.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
